Actor and former California Govenor Arnold Schwarzenegger has debuted on the US version of 'The Apprentice'.

'The Terminator' star has taken over from Donald Trump, who will shortly become the president of the United States.

Schwarzenegger is now the boss over 16 celebrities - including 'Culture Club' singer Boy George.

The celebrities are competing to be crowned the winner for their favourite charities.

But in a twist, the show has been moved from New York to to Los Angeles for its eighth season.

Advising Schwarzenegger in his new role is investment guru Warren Buffett, former Microsoft CEO Steve Ballmer, supermodel and actress Tyra Banks and Schwarzenegger's nephew, Patrick Knapp Schwarzenegger.

NBC says Patrick Knapp Schwarzenegger is the actor's "trusted confidante".

This season's winner will gain the title of the Celebrity Apprentice, and a US$250,000 cheque to give to their designated charity.
